  After 14 years of planning, fundraising and eventually building, St. Ambrose Church in Annandale opened the doors to its new church July 15. More than 800 parishioners and guests attended the Mass of dedication celebrated by Bishop Michael F. Burbidge and concelebrated by Bishop Emeritus Paul S. Filming of the fourth season of “The Chosen,” the popular Christian television series about Jesus and his disciples, will continue after a union granted the production an exemption from its strike against major Hollywood studios. A new Catholic ministry aims to bring families together and bring a “taste of heaven” into their homes. Trinity House Community Groups offer families formation, fellowship, and the tools needed to live out their faith and pass it on to their children.
